Magnetic Black vs Twilight Sky

Wrap comparison · updated Aug 2026

Magnetic Black (#0F0F17) reads darker than Twilight Sky (#5975E4), so it holds shadow in the body lines where Twilight Sky lifts them. Both films carry a metallic finish, so the choice is purely the colour. Body shape, paint condition and the light you shoot in move both colours further than a swatch chip suggests. Questions

Which is darker, Magnetic Black or Twilight Sky?
Magnetic Black is the darker of the two. Its swatch, #0F0F17, has a lower relative luminance than Twilight Sky at #5975E4.
What finishes do Magnetic Black and Twilight Sky come in?
Both are metallic films — the sheen belongs to the film itself, so there is no separate finish to choose.
